Hey小伙伴们,今天要和大家分享一个超实用的小技巧——如何用Python来制作一个简单的乘方计算器,是不是听起来就很酷?别急,跟着我一步步来,保证你也能轻松!
我们需要了解什么是乘方,乘方是指一个数自乘若干次的操作,比如2的3次方就是2乘以2乘以2,结果是8,在Python中,我们可以用运算符来实现乘方运算。
我们来编写一个简单的乘方计算器,这个计算器会让用户输入一个底数和一个指数,然后计算出结果,代码如下:
乘方计算器
def power_calculator(base, exponent):
return base ** exponent
用户输入底数和指数
base = float(input("请输入底数:"))
exponent = int(input("请输入指数:"))
计算乘方结果
result = power_calculator(base, exponent)
输出结果
print(f"{base} 的 {exponent} 次方是 {result}")这段代码首先定义了一个函数power_calculator,它接受两个参数:底数base和指数exponent,并返回它们的乘方结果,我们通过input函数获取用户的输入,并将其转换为适当的数据类型(底数转换为浮点数,指数转换为整数),我们调用power_calculator函数计算结果,并打印出来。
让我们来试试这个计算器,你可以在任何Python环境中运行上面的代码,比如IDLE、Jupyter Notebook或者直接在命令行里,当你运行代码后,它会提示你输入底数和指数,输入完成后,它就会显示出乘方的结果。
如果你想计算3的4次方,你可以这样输入:
请输入底数:3 请输入指数:4
计算器会输出:
3、0 的 4 次方是 81.0
看,是不是很简单?这个乘方计算器虽然简单,但是它展示了Python处理数学运算的强大能力,你可以在此基础上添加更多的功能,比如错误处理,让用户的输入更加健壮,或者增加图形界面,让计算器更加友好。
如果你对Python感兴趣,或者想要了解更多编程知识,记得持续关注我哦!我会不定期分享更多有趣的编程技巧和项目,编程不仅仅是一门技术,它还是一种解决问题的工具,让我们一起在编程的世界里更多可能性吧!
如果你有任何问题或者想要讨论更多关于Python的话题,欢迎在评论区留下你的想法,让我们一起交流,一起进步!别忘了点赞和转发,让更多的朋友加入到我们的编程旅程中来!



还没有评论,来说两句吧...